Introduction

AI Translation

The Model 1865 is a high-performance sensor specifically designed to meet the demands of medical and professional OEM applications. This model offers laser-trimmed compensation and can be specified to operate with either a constant-current or constant-voltage supply. The Model 1865 employs a solid-state piezoresistive pressure sensor mounted in a plastic package. For applications where force is applied to the sensor through a flexible diaphragm, such as infusion pumps, the Model 1865's precision high-silicon diaphragm offers long service life and serves as a reliable replacement for older force or load sensors. With a silicone rubber diaphragm, the Model 1865 is suitable for certain liquid media applications. The Model 1865 provides critical safety functions for critical care medical instruments, such as occlusion pressure or infiltration detection. Pressure data can provide medical personnel with useful diagnostic information regarding a patient's circulatory condition. These force/pressure sensors can also be used with other medical dispensing equipment, such as syringe pumps, to enhance safety and accuracy. The Model 1865 operates under current or voltage excitation, and its output can be amplified or signal-conditioned as required. The semiconductor-based sensor employs a Wheatstone bridge strain gauge design, delivering high resolution. The patented in-situ potted silicone rubber diaphragm height of the device is controlled to ensure sensitivity to low pressures. The diaphragm is bonded to the plastic header and transfers the applied force to the diaphragm of the silicon piezoresistive chip through a special silicone gel. The back side of the chip is exposed to atmospheric pressure, thereby producing a gauge pressure output.

Features

AI Translation
  • Silicon pressure/force interface diaphragm
  • Force measurement for infusion pump applications
  • Pressure measurement for liquid media
  • Medical-grade materials
  • 8-pin DIP electrical connection
  • Laser trimming
  • Optional voltage or constant current excitation

Applications

AI Translation
  • Infusion pump
  • Anesthesia monitor
  • Non-corrosive, non-pressurized media level sensor
  • Ventilation system
  • Blood pressure device
